Top 10 Change Data Capture (CDC) Tools: Features, Pros, Cons & Comparison

Introduction

Change Data Capture (CDC) tools are designed to track and stream changes in databases—such as inserts, updates, and deletes—in near real time. Instead of repeatedly querying entire tables or running heavy batch jobs, CDC tools efficiently capture only what has changed and deliver those changes to downstream systems like data warehouses, analytics platforms, search indexes, and event-driven applications.

In today’s data-driven environments, CDC has become critical. Modern businesses rely on real-time insights, low-latency analytics, and event-based architectures. Whether it’s syncing operational databases to analytics platforms, feeding microservices with up-to-date data, or enabling streaming pipelines, CDC tools help reduce load on source systems while keeping data consistent and fresh.

Common real-world use cases include:

  • Real-time analytics and dashboards
  • Database replication and synchronization
  • Event-driven microservices
  • Data warehousing and lake ingestion
  • Disaster recovery and audit tracking

When choosing a CDC tool, users should evaluate database compatibility, latency, scalability, fault tolerance, ease of integration, security, and operational complexity. The right tool balances performance with reliability and fits naturally into existing data architectures.

Best for:
CDC tools are ideal for data engineers, backend architects, DevOps teams, and analytics engineers working in SMBs to large enterprises, especially in industries like finance, e-commerce, healthcare, SaaS, and logistics where real-time data accuracy matters.

Not ideal for:
Organizations with small, static datasets, infrequent data changes, or purely batch-oriented workflows may not need CDC tools. In such cases, simpler ETL or scheduled exports can be more cost-effective and easier to maintain.


Top 10 Change Data Capture (CDC) Tools

1 — Debezium

Short description:
An open-source CDC platform built on Kafka that streams database changes in real time. Designed for engineers building event-driven and streaming architectures.

Key features:

  • Log-based CDC for minimal database impact
  • Native integration with Kafka
  • Supports MySQL, PostgreSQL, MongoDB, SQL Server, Oracle
  • Schema change tracking
  • Exactly-once delivery semantics
  • Scalable and fault-tolerant architecture

Pros:

  • Open-source and highly extensible
  • Strong ecosystem and community

Cons:

  • Requires Kafka expertise
  • Operationally complex for beginners

Security & compliance:
Supports encryption in transit; compliance varies by deployment.

Support & community:
Excellent documentation and active open-source community; enterprise support via partners.


2 — AWS Database Migration Service (DMS)

Short description:
A managed CDC and migration service for AWS users, optimized for replicating data into AWS ecosystems.

Key features:

  • Continuous replication with low latency
  • Supports homogeneous and heterogeneous databases
  • Automated scaling and monitoring
  • Integration with AWS analytics services
  • Minimal source database impact

Pros:

  • Fully managed service
  • Easy setup for AWS-native workloads

Cons:

  • Limited customization
  • Best suited only for AWS environments

Security & compliance:
Encryption, IAM-based access control, compliance aligned with AWS standards.

Support & community:
Strong AWS documentation and enterprise-grade support.


3 — Oracle GoldenGate

Short description:
An enterprise-grade CDC and replication solution built for mission-critical systems and complex database environments.

Key features:

  • Real-time data replication
  • High availability and disaster recovery
  • Multi-database and cross-platform support
  • Advanced filtering and transformations
  • Extremely low latency

Pros:

  • Proven enterprise reliability
  • High performance at scale

Cons:

  • Expensive licensing
  • Complex configuration

Security & compliance:
Strong enterprise security, audit logging, and compliance certifications.

Support & community:
Premium enterprise support and extensive documentation.

Frequently Asked Questions (FAQs)

1. What is Change Data Capture?
CDC is a method for tracking database changes in real time without scanning entire tables.

2. How does CDC differ from ETL?
CDC focuses on incremental changes, while ETL often relies on batch processing.

3. Is CDC safe for production databases?
Yes, log-based CDC minimizes performance impact when properly configured.

4. Do CDC tools support schema changes?
Most modern CDC tools handle schema evolution automatically.

5. Can CDC tools work across clouds?
Yes, many support hybrid and multi-cloud deployments.

6. Are CDC tools expensive?
Costs vary widely—from free open-source tools to premium enterprise platforms.

7. Do I need Kafka for CDC?
Not always, but Kafka-based tools offer superior scalability.

8. Is CDC suitable for analytics?
Yes, CDC is widely used for real-time analytics pipelines.

9. What are common CDC challenges?
Schema drift, operational complexity, and latency tuning.

10. When should I avoid CDC?
If data changes infrequently or batch updates are sufficient.
